Nation IN BRIEF : GEORGIA : Leland Widow Gives Birth to Twin Boys
From Times Staff and Wire Reports
The widow of Texas Rep. Mickey Leland, who was expecting at the time of his death in a plane crash in Ethiopia last summer, gave birth to twin boys at an Atlanta hospital, a spokesman said. Alison Leland, 31, was in town for festivities surrounding today’s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. national holiday. She and the twins are doing well, the spokesman said. But the infants, several weeks premature, are in a special care nursery.
